Humanity: The majority of the survivors. During the dark days they played with the cards they where dealt, and ended up surviving. They are the majority on Earth. the other races (although still human) have been empowered by them, so they may all survive.
The Awoken: During the fall of the Golden Age, some sought to preserve themself. They entered a state cryogenic freeze, fully expecting to be awakened once the clamity had past. But many millenia past before they where discovered, deep in the ruins of the old cities. When they were awoken they had no recolection of what they were. Just where they came from. They are relics of the old age. Time again they have tried to explain to us their tech, of the modifications made to our self. What these modifications used to do, we do not know and they have forgoten. The most obvious fact is it turns the skin blue. But now they provide a strong link to the traveler.
The Exo: In our dark days, some looked to science to persevere. They decided in order to fight their enemy, they would have to become something stronger. So they did. These humans reconstructed their dna at the base levels to produce more useful things out of food. When injected with a healthy portion of nanobots, they created the exo. Biological machines. The nanobots gather the carbon strands and weave them into a skin-like substance stronger than steel. The nanobots also reinforce and support the mussles and bones, giving the exo above avarage strength. These humans are forever encased in these bodies, only the most invasive surgery, or violent explosion could possibly separate them. As such they have become one with machine
